Argentina's university nuggets 🎓

  • Universidad de Buenos Aires (UBA) Argentina's largest university and one of the most prestigious in the Americas. Master's degrees in strategic digital marketing management and international economic relations are taught and recognized here. Fact: Four of Argentina's five Nobel Prize winners were students and professors at this university.
  • Universidad Nacional de Córdoba (UNC) Córdoba: Ideal for students of economics, business and international relations, it offers a rigorous academic environment with an international outlook. What's more, Córdoba offers a dynamic student experience with a lower cost of living than Buenos Aires.
  • Instituto Tecnológico de Buenos Aires (ITBA) ITBA: Argentina's oldest university, it offers a different, quieter setting than Buenos Aires. If engineering and technology are your fields, ITBA will be your springboard to innovation and the development of ambitious projects.

Specific advice for an exchange in Argentina

Once you've chosen your university and prepared for the big departure, it's time to think about how to live this Argentine adventure to the full. Let me guide you so that every day is a day of discovery and enrichment. Your university exchange in Argentina is a unique opportunity to grow, learn and open up to the world. By following these tips, you'll ensure a rich and unforgettable experience 🥩

  • Fluency in Argentinean Spanish 💬: Spanish spoken in Argentina has its own peculiarities, including the use of "vos" instead of "tú" for "tutoiement", and a distinct accent. Immersing yourself in the specifics of Argentine Spanish before you leave or as soon as you arrive will make daily life and integration easier.
  • Adapt to the Argentine rhythm ⏳ : Argentinians live at their own pace. Here, days start later and end later. Let yourself be carried away by this new routine: enjoy your dinner at 9pm or later and discover the emblematic nightlife of Buenos Aires or Córdoba long after midnight.
  • Participate in local events 🎉 Argentina is famous for its tango, folk music and film festivals. Take part in these events to immerse yourself fully in the culture.
  • Understand the local economy 💹 Argentina has a volatile economy with a fluctuating exchange rate. Find out about "Cambio Blue," the unofficial exchange rate, which is often more favorable for foreigners. Use local apps and websites to track exchange rates and plan your spending accordingly.
  • Explore geographical diversity 🏞️ : Don't limit yourself to the capital. Argentina is incredibly diverse, from Iguazú Falls in the north to the glaciers of Patagonia in the south. Plan excursions to explore the country's natural wealth.
  • Taste Argentinian cuisine 🍽️ Argentina: Take advantage of your stay to discover the local cuisine, including the famous asado (Argentine barbecue), empanadas and mate, a traditional drink.

Study in Peru: Essential guide for your student exchange 🗺️

You're about to embark on one of the most rewarding experiences of your life: a university exchange to the land of llamas. Are you ready? Here's everything you need to know to make your Peruvian adventure a complete success 🌟

Peruvian university nuggets 🎓

Peru is home to prestigious universities, renowned for their academic excellence and rich student life. Here are a few not to be missed:

  • Pontificia Universidad Católica del Perú (PUCP) : In Lima, this private university is known for its novel, modern campus and programs in management, operations and finance.
  • Universidad de Piura (UDEP) With its campuses in Piura and Lima, its most internationally recognized masters programs are in maritime law and port management, but they also offer excellent courses in international business.
  • Universidad Nacional Mayor de San Marcos (UNMSM) Founded in 1551, it is the oldest university in the Americas and one of Peru's leading centers of learning, particularly renowned in the social sciences, health and law.

Specific advice for an exchange in Peru

  • Immerse yourself in language and culture 📚: Peru is a cultural country that can't be ignored. Mastering Spanish will not only make it easier for you to follow your courses, but will also help you immerse yourself in local life. Take every opportunity to practice the language, whether in class, with friends or even on your adventures.
  • Adapt and live like a Peruvian ⏰ Peru offers incredible climatic and cultural diversity. Whether you're in Lima, with its coastal desert climate, or in the Andes, where the weather can be cooler and rainier, each region has its own rhythm of life. Embrace this diversity and make these differences an integral part of your experience.
  • Explore Peru's natural and historical wealth 🌄 : This country is full of wonders, from Machu Picchu to the Nazca lines and Lake Titicaca. Each destination reveals a different aspect of this fascinating country. Don't miss the opportunity to travel and discover as much as you can.
  • Enjoy Peruvian gastronomy 🍽️ Peru is a foodie's paradise, with dishes such as ceviche, causa rellena and lomo saltado. Peruvian cuisine is a unique blend of indigenous, Spanish, African and Asian traditions. Every meal is a culinary exploration.
